What is Web3 Security?

Web3 security, in simple terms, is the application of security practices to the decentralized web—Web3. It’s all about safeguarding data and digital assets in a decentralized network. This includes protection from common threats like data breaches and hacking, as well as uniquely Web3 threats like smart contract bugs and DeFi exploits. AI ID Verification: The What and the How

AI ID verification is all about using artificial intelligence to confirm identities in the digital realm. Here are some ways AI does this:

  1. Biometric verification: AI can analyze biometric data—like fingerprints or facial recognition—to verify that you're really you.
  2. Document verification: AI can also check documents like passports or driver's licenses, verifying their authenticity and the information they contain.
  3. Behavioural analysis: Believe it or not, AI can even look at how you behave—like how you type or move your mouse—to confirm your identity.

Case Study 1: AI and Smart Contract Audits

Smart contracts are a big deal in Web3. They're like self-executing contracts with the terms written into code. But they can also be a big security risk if they're not written correctly. That's where AI comes in.

  • MythX: MythX is a security analysis tool that uses AI to find vulnerabilities in Ethereum smart contracts. It's like having a super-smart code reviewer who never sleeps!

Case Study 2: AI and Blockchain Analysis

Blockchain is at the heart of Web3, but it can also be a maze of information. AI can help to make sense of it all.

  • Elliptic: Elliptic is a platform that uses AI to identify and track illegal activities on the blockchain. It's like a detective that can follow the money, no matter where it goes.

Case Study 3: AI and Decentralized Identity

Identity is a complex issue in Web3. But AI is helping to create solutions that are both secure and user-friendly.

  • uPort: uPort uses AI to offer a self-sovereign identity model. Users can manage their own identities, and AI helps to keep everything secure.

Challenge 3: Privacy Concerns

With great power comes great responsibility, right? AI can access and analyze a lot of data, which can lead to privacy concerns.

  • Solution: Privacy-Preserving AI: New techniques in AI, like federated learning and differential privacy, can help to analyze data without compromising privacy.
